During 2016, the HUF to PYG ex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on February 7, valuing the pair at 21.1705.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 20, dropping to 19.1931.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 1.9774 PYG.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 20.3769 to the December average rate of 19.5583, the exchange rate registered a net change of -4.02% (reflecting a weakening trend).
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2016 high of 21.1705 was up 1.45% compared to the 2015 peak of 20.8683,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)
SeasonalThe average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 20.3850, compared to 19.9609 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 0.4241 points.
Volatility Range Comparison
VolatilityThe most volatile month in 2016 was June, with a trading range of 1.1346 PYG (High: 20.7446 / Low: 19.6100). On the other end, July was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.4451 PYG (High: 19.9727 / Low: 19.5276).
Growth Streaks & Declines
TrendsBetween July and October,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 3 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between November and December, when the average rate fell by 0.5993 points.
Same-Month Historical Baseline
YoY BaselineComparing the current year's strongest month average (February 2016: 20.7645) against the same month in 2015 (average: 17.6433), the exchange rate shifted by +3.1212 (+17.69%).
Monthly Breakdown
Statistical summary for each calendar month.
| Month | High | Low |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 20.7023 | 19.9542 | 20.3769 |
| February | 21.1705 | 20.0801 | 20.7645 |
| March | 20.7516 | 19.9717 | 20.3955 |
| April | 20.5083 | 19.9680 | 20.2994 |
| May | 20.6347 | 19.8920 | 20.2010 |
| June | 20.7446 | 19.6100 | 20.2728 |
| July | 19.9727 | 19.5276 | 19.6943 |
| August | 20.2435 | 19.7597 | 19.9976 |
| September | 20.4783 | 19.8880 | 20.1773 |
| October | 20.5109 | 19.9348 | 20.1804 |
| November | 20.7749 | 19.7600 | 20.1576 |
| December | 19.9862 | 19.1931 | 19.5583 |
